8 Instagram Story Ideas For Growth

Instagram stories are a great way to engage with your audience. 62% of people say they have become more interested in a brand or product after seeing it in Stories

But….What do you really post on Instagram stories?

Think of the value that you can provide with IG stories and show some personal connection. Here are some story ideas to boost the growth on your Instagram.

1️⃣ Mini Trainings

By giving away free bite-size pieces of training that your audience can implement immediately, you are sharing with them and not selling. Remember that people don’t want to be sold to.

Your audiences are more likely wanting to engage with actionable tips that they can apply to their business. So, instead of sharing endless sales marketing promo stories for your paid course or training program every day, hosting these mini-trainings helps your audiences see you as a coach or consultant in your respective field.

At the end of it, engage with them through some content related to your offer. A subtle way of letting your audiences know that if they liked what they have seen, you have something for them in a paid capacity without being too “salesy”.

 2️⃣  Behind The Scenes

Show your audiences behind-the-scenes of what you do. Let them see your personal workspace where all the magic behind your business happens.

You can even share how you prepare for your IG live episode, your client meetings, what are you currently working on (your new offer) or give your audiences a glimpse of how you are taking your brand to the top.

3️⃣ Valuable Insights

Have a hack or strategy to share? Or have you got some tips and tricks from your expertise to give? Show it on Instagram stories! Doing so will boost your engagements and will become a trustworthy source of information.

4️⃣ A Service or Tool

So, you’ve already shared some sneak peeks on the latest offer you are working on or how you are creating content, share with them the tools or the services you’re using. Ones that you have been using and has helped you in your business.

5️⃣ Share A Book

 What you read is what you become. It’s good to update your audiences on how you are investing in yourself and constantly learning so that you can be at the top of your game and be the best coach for them.

So, what books are you reading? Is this about marketing or food for your soul? Share the book and your thoughts or biggest takeaways from the book.

6️⃣ Testimonials or Reviews

There are many coaches, consultants and course creators in the same niche as you, so what REALLY sets you apart? Social proof is great to have because this shows the transformation and results when working with you. Reviews and testimonials are still the most trusted form of building trust.

7️⃣ Share Your Personal Development

Inspire others by words of encouragement that inspires. Share what you have been working on for personal growth and what you are discovering in your daily life.

For example, I’m on a journey to living a healthier life trying to wake up at 5am everyday. Instagram story is a great way of documenting the journey and taking my audiences along. An insight into your personal life on a deeper level. This helps create the relationship and might even be an icebreaker to start a conversation in the DMs.

8️⃣ Transformation

Now, share something that you have helped achieve with your clients. Let your audiences see how you have helped your clients reach their goals. Keep sharing how you can provide the transformation and results.

You can do this by showing screenshots of your clients’ testimonial or feedback. Over time, this helps to build a strong rapport and trust with your audiences.

Now that you have some ideas to use over the next few days, remember to include call-to-action (CTA).

Here are some of the features you can include in your stories:

  • Questions sticker
  • Poll
  • Engagement slide
  • DM Me
  • Countdown sticker
  • Quiz
  • Location
  • Hashtags

Always include a CTA, an action that leads your ideal client onto the next step of your customer journey. Now that you have some content ideas to share, it’s time to hop onto stories.
